Hidden Home Pests
Are you aware of the hidden family bugs that may be prowling in your home? While you may be vigilant about usual insects like ants or crawlers, there are other tricky intruders that could be causing injury behind the scenes.
One such insect is the silverfish, a little pest that prospers in wet and dark atmospheres like basements and restrooms. These parasites can harm books, apparel, and even wallpaper, making them a hassle to take care of.
One more covert insect to look out for is the carpeting beetle. These small bugs feed on a variety of products discovered in homes, such as carpetings, clothing, and furniture. Their larvae can create significant damages if left untreated, making it essential to address any type of indicators of problem immediately.
In addition, mold termites are typically overlooked however can show a dampness problem in your house. These small creatures prey on mold and can worsen allergic reactions for sensitive people. Maintaining your home dry and well-ventilated can aid prevent these parasites from residing in your home.
Stay alert and deal with any kind of signs of these concealed family bugs to keep your home pest-free.

Here are a couple of stealthy home intruders you should keep an eye out for:
1. ** Silverfish **: These tiny, silvery bugs love damp, dark spaces like cellars and shower rooms. They feed upon starchy materials and can cause damage to publications, wallpaper, and clothes.
2. ** Carpeting Beetles **: Usually mistaken for harmless ladybugs, carpet beetles can damage your home. Their larvae feed on all-natural fibers like wool and silk, causing irreversible damage to carpets, garments, and furniture.
3. ** Earwigs **: Regardless of their ominous-looking pincers, earwigs are more of an annoyance than a danger. They're brought in to moisture and can locate their method into your home with splits and gaps. Keep an eye out for them in moist areas like kitchens and bathrooms.
